BBVA Loan definition

BBVA Loan means the loans provided pursuant to the US$197,000,000 Loan Agreement, dated on or about the date hereof, as amended from time to time, by and among the Company, BBVA Securities Inc., BBVA Bancomer S.A., Institución de Banca Múltiple, Grupo Financiero BBVA Bancomer, and the several lenders party thereto.

  • Cov-Lite Loan A Collateral Obligation the Underlying Documents for which do not (i) contain any financial covenants or (ii) require the Obligor thereunder to comply with any Maintenance Covenant (regardless of whether compliance with one or more Incurrence Covenants is otherwise required by such Underlying Documents); provided that, notwithstanding the foregoing, a Collateral Obligation shall be deemed for all purposes (other than the S&P Recovery Rate for such Collateral Obligation) not to be a Cov-Lite Loan if the Underlying Documents for such Collateral Obligation contain a cross-default or cross acceleration provision to, or such Collateral Obligation is pari passu with, another loan, debt obligation or credit facility of the underlying Obligor that contains one or more Maintenance Covenants.

  • DIP Loan Any Loan (i) with respect to which the related Obligor is a debtor-in-possession as defined under the Bankruptcy Code, (ii) which has the priority allowed pursuant to Section 364 of the Bankruptcy Code and (iii) the terms of which have been approved by a court of competent jurisdiction (the enforceability of which is not subject to any pending contested matter or proceeding).
